WINTER WEATHER ADVISORY IN EFFECT FROM 8 PM MONDAY TO 5 PM MST TUESDAY
Winter Weather Advisory issued February 15 at 1:06PM MST until February 17 at 5:00PM MST by NWS Flagstaff AZ
* WHAT...Snow expected. Total snow accumulations of 3 to 6 inches
above 6500 feet, with locally higher amounts of up to 8 inches
possible. Winds gusting as high as 50 mph.
* WHERE...Mogollon Rim, Kaibab Plateau, and White Mountains.
* WHEN...From 8 PM Monday to 5 PM MST Tuesday.
* IMPACTS...Roads, and especially bridges and overpasses, will likely
become slick and hazardous. Periods of moderate to heavy snowfall
will create snow-covered roads and hazardous driving conditions.
The hazardous conditions will impact the Tuesday morning commute.
Gusty winds could bring down tree branches.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
Forecast snowfall amounts from 8 PM MST Monday to 5 PM MST
Tuesday...
Alpine: 1 to 2" Forest Lakes: 4 to 6"
Fredonia: Trace to 1" Doney Park: 2 to 4"
Flagstaff: 2 to 4" Munds Park: 2 to 4"
Pine-Strawberry: 1 to 2" Whiteriver: Trace to 1"
Williams: 2 to 4" Heber-Overgaard: Trace to 1"
Jacob Lake: 4 to 6" Pinetop-Lakeside: Trace to 1"
Show Low: 0"
